Space Debris Mitigation Engineer Develops and implements strategies to reduce space debris, focusing on risk assessment and mitigation techniques. High demand due to growing space activity.
Space Situational Awareness Analyst Analyzes space debris data, predicts potential collisions, and assesses risks to operational satellites. Critical role in ensuring safe space operations.
Orbital Debris Modeller Develops and utilizes computer models to simulate space debris environments and predict future risk scenarios. Strong mathematical and programming skills needed.
Space Debris Risk Consultant Provides expert advice and assessment of space debris risks to clients in the aerospace industry. Excellent communication and problem-solving skills essential.
